Let’s strip away the marketing. Validators in a Proof-of-Stake network are responsible for proposing and voting on blocks. They stake tokens—XDC in this case—and earn rewards for honest participation. Slashing penalties for misbehavior. The security model relies on the assumption that a majority of staked value is controlled by honest actors. Traditional assumption: anonymous or pseudonymous validators can collude. Institutional validators bring reputation capital. They are regulated entities. The cost of cheating is not just slashed tokens but a destroyed business license.
Clear Street is a registered broker-dealer with the SEC and FINRA. They handle billions in daily trading volume. Their infrastructure is built for low-latency, high-compliance operations. By running an XDC validator node, they are effectively saying: “We trust this network enough to put our name on the line.” That is a signal. But is it a signal of substance?

Then the market moves on. The real impact requires three things: active staking, code contributions, and business integration.
Active staking: Clear Street must lock up XDC tokens to validate. That reduces circulating supply, bullish for price. But the amount is not disclosed. If they stake a token amount, it’s a rounding error for a firm of their size. If they stake millions, it’s meaningful. We don’t know.
Code contributions: Institutional validators often run modified clients with custom monitoring. Clear Street might contribute to XDC’s node software, improving stability or security. But there is no evidence. The code does not lie, but it does hide—and here it hides everything.
Business integration: The real prize. Clear Street could use XDC Network for settlement of tokenized securities or trade finance. That would drive transaction volume, increasing fee revenue for validators. But that is speculation. The press release only mentions validator role, not any product integration.
Now, the contrarian angle. Institutional validators are a double-edged sword. They centralize governance. If the network becomes dominated by a handful of regulated entities, the permissionless nature erodes. XDC already has a permissioned flavor—it uses a delegated proof-of-stake with a limited set of validators. Adding Clear Street might make it more attractive to regulators, but less attractive to the cypherpunk crowd. The network gains legitimacy but loses the narrative of decentralization. That trade-off is rarely discussed in the hype cycle.

Let’s look at the technicals. XDC uses a modified DBFT consensus. It claims high throughput (up to 2,000 TPS). But I’ve seen many enterprise chains claim high TPS and fail under real load. The real test is latency and finality. Clear Street, being a high-frequency trading firm, will demand sub-second finality. If XDC cannot deliver, Clear Street will leave. That pressure might force the network to upgrade, which is good for all users.
